SYNOPSIS
Bed
sheets dangle in the darkness. The dangerous criminals
are over. The guard shoots, misses. A stolen car waits,
they speed off. They make it to the expressway with
Police in pursuit. A road block on the Mooney bridge
and the criminals are forced off the road, crashing
through dense bush. They foot it through the blackness.
A building lights up on an island across the water.
Jeremy
Shew is on stage, laughter fills the Comedy Store. He's
good, real good. A man walks in, along the wall, angles
down, looks through demented eyes. A women waits nervously
back stage, she spots him, he spots her. Jeremy watches
closely. She leaves, the man follows
He is upon
her now, she screams. Jeremy pounces, the crazy cop
holds his gun on the crazy stalker.
Mental
patients wander around the asylum's dormitory. Some
laugh hysterically, others stare wide eyed, void. An
insane face looks out, the window smashes, he runs off
inside giggling. The wet criminals are inside now
Jeremy
is called.
So
begins the story of a tension filled psychological action/thriller
which speeds along like a freight train. A gripping
tale that will have you on the edge of your seat right
up to it's climax.
Detective
Jeremy Shew is a cop with a difference. Driven by a
past tragedy that happened in the line of duty which
still torments him. This loony cop and the mental patients
join forces. Throw in the crazy stalker and together
they become the unlikely hero's of the nations most
infamous hostage seige.
